Screw plug immersion heater are designed to heat liquids (water, oil, heavy fuel oil, glycol, etc.) or gases (air, nitrogen, CO2, etc.) statically in a tank or container, or by forced convection in a circulating fluid heater. They consist of a compact bundle of tubular heating elements, usually pin-shaped, available in various materials compatible with the fluids to be heated. The sealed shielding of the heating elements provides mechanical protection and protection against corrosion.
The heating elements are brazed or welded onto a threaded plug, allowing the immersion heater to be screwed onto a container equipped with a threaded sleeve. This connection allows for a sealed installation up to a maximum of 25 bar.
Screw plug immersion heater be equipped with safety or control devices (probes, thermocouples, thermostats) and a protective connector box.

  • Unit power up to 72 kW, max. voltage 750 V (three-phase). Single- or three-phase power supply.
  • Reduced inertia and maximum efficiency, as the heating elements are in direct contact with the fluid.
  • Easy to install and maintain.
  • Wide choice of stocked, ready-to-use products, with short delivery times available from our online catalog.
  • Numerous configuration options: wattage, voltage, immersion length, resistor and plug material, plug thread Ø, etc.

Applications

Screw plug immersion heater are used Screw plug immersion heater a wide range of applications: energy, marine, automotive, petrochemical, aerospace, processing industries, etc. Below are a few examples of their use:

Food industry

Water heating in poultry scalding tanks. Scalding is an essential step in the poultry slaughtering process, ensuring good plucking results.

Automotive

Oil heating for filling stations for gearboxes and engines. Oil heating reduces viscosity and facilitates pumping.

Marine

Hot water supply on ships.

Energy sector

Temperature maintenance of glycol water in cooling circuits

Technical data

Screw plug immersion heater of:

  • Shielded electrical resistors make up the heater core of the immersion heater. Their quantity and diameter (8, 10.2 or 16 mm) vary according to the size of the fixing plug. Several materials are available (Inox 321, Inox 316L, Inox 904L, Incoloy 825®, Incoloy 800®). Heating elements can be straight, shaped as single or double pins.
  • The fixing plug is a threaded connection to ISO metric standard (M45 or M77) or cylindrical gas standard (1'' to 2''1/2). Other standards and thread diameters available on request. The plug is fitted with a hexagon to facilitate tightening when installing the immersion heater.
  • Electrical terminals for immersion heater power supply. Several terminal models available (threaded, with holes, flat, Faston) or direct wire outputs.
  • The thermowell (optional) enables the installation of a safety or control device (probe, thermocouple or thermostat) for measuring fluid temperature, or a heating resistor. It consists of a sealed tube on the fluid side, open on the connector side to allow insertion of the measuring element.
  • The offset base is designed for mounting an enclosure to protect the connectors when they are offset. The offset is justified when the temperature of the fluid to be heated exceeds 110°C, to prevent overheating at the terminals.

Further information

  • Screw plug immersion heater designed, manufactured, and tested to meet the essential safety requirements of PED 2014/68/EU. They can therefore be installed on vessels subject to PED (Pressure Equipment Directive) up to risk category I, within the applicable PS, TS max, and TS min limits.
  • Vulcanic offers ATEX and/or IECEx certified immersion heaters for potentially explosive atmospheres. For surface industries, for use in risk zones 1 and 2, and for temperature classes from T1 to T6.

Recommendations

Precautions for use

When heating a liquid, install the immersion heater in such a way that the heating section is constantly submerged. Otherwise, there is a risk of overheating and destruction of the equipment. The liquid level must be continuously monitored.

In the case of installation in a circulating heater, before switching on the power, the direction of circulation must be checked, purging must be carried out to eliminate air pockets, and the recommended minimum flow rate must be ensured.

In the case of circulating gas heating, it is essential to constantly monitor the flow of gas to be heated. This is particularly important when the power supply is disconnected. The gas flow must be maintained until the heating elements have cooled down completely.

Installation and connection

Horizontal mounting (+/-15°) is preferred. In the case of vertical mounting, the junction box should preferably be placed at the bottom. In the case of vertical mounting with the junction box in the upper part, monitor the temperature of the junction box.
